Bar screens are the initial line in a wastewater treatment plant. Their main function consists of removing large debris including sticks, rags, and waste. These screens generally made of metal bars, which create a barrier to prevent these massive objects from moving into the following stages of the treatment process. Without bar screens, sewage wastewater systems would quickly become blocked, making it impossible to treat the water effectively.

Gantry Cranes: Versatile Lifting Solutions for Heavy Industries
Gantry cranes are critical lifting solutions widely used in manufacturing industries. These robust and reliable structures feature a pair of overhead rails on which traveling bridge structure moves. This bridge is outfitted with winches capable of moving heavy loads. Gantry cranes are indispensable for a diverse range of applications, including , assembly, and maintenance. Their ability to operate in confined spaces makes them particularly appropriate for industrial plants, construction sites, large-scale facilities
The design of gantry cranes can be modified to meet the unique needs of each application. Elements such as lifting capacity, span length, and work conditions are all taken into account when designing a lifting solution.
